Description
Nightingale Cottage is a Grade II Listed property
constructed of Cotswold stone. Dating from
the early to mid-eighteenth century with later
additions, the current owner has recently
completed a comprehensive programme of
refurbishment to create a superb home. The
well-presented accommodation is set out
over three floors and comprises a generous
triple aspect sitting room with an impressive
inglenook fireplace and double doors leading
out to the garden. The large windows have
window seats and wooden shutters. The sitting
room opens into the dining room which has a
fireplace with a wood burning stove. Off the
entrance hall is the kitchen which is fitted with
an excellent range of country style floor and wall
units and a Belfast sink. A glazed door
leads to the garden.

From the hall, stairs rise to the first floor landing
off which is wonderful principal bedroom suite
with dressing room with fitted cupboards, and
a luxurious, well-appointed bathroom with
separate shower cubicle. Also on the first floor is
bedroom two and a useful utility room with WC
and storage. On the second floor are two further
excellent bedrooms which share a shower room.

The garden is a particular feature of this
property, arranged as discrete areas, linked by
rose arches and enclosed by dry stone walling
on all sides to provide a sense of complete
privacy. The paved upper terrace is ideal for
outdoor dining and entertaining. There is also a
pond, water feature and a wide variety of
established shrubs, trees and well-stocked
flowerbeds. There is a single garage, store
and parking to the side of the house. Planning
permission has been obtained to raise the
garage roof to provide a home office at
first floor level under planning reference
20/01001/FUL dated 13 August 2020.

Cherington is located in the attractive
rolling countryside on the Warwickshire/
Oxfordshire borders within the Cotswold Area
of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The village is
conveniently situated for easy access to both
Shipston-on-Stour and Chipping Norton.
The area is well served by a network of main
roads providing access to the larger centres
of Oxford, Banbury and Stratford-upon-Avon
which provide first class state and private
schools and a wide range of cultural and leisure
facilities. The M40 (J11) at Banbury provides
access north to Birmingham and the Midlands
and south to Oxford and London. There are
mainline stations at Banbury and Moretonin-
Marsh with regular rail services to London
Marylebone and Paddington respectively.
